Actor Walton Goggins, known for his recent Emmy-nominated performance in "Fallout," has opened up about his experience filming "The White Lotus" season 3, revealing the unexpected financial implications of staying at the luxurious resort.

During an appearance on "The Late Show," Goggins shared details of his six-month shoot in Thailand, expressing gratitude for the opportunity to stay at the five-star hotel used as both an accommodation and shooting location. However, he also highlighted an unexpected cost associated with checking out of the prestigious establishment.

Goggins clarified that while room stays were covered during filming, incidentals such as food and beverages were not included in the accommodation package. "What they don't tell you when you check into the White Lotus is how expensive it is to check out of the White Lotus," he revealed, emphasizing that this was not just an issue for him but for everyone involved in the production.

The actor shared a humorous anecdote about receiving his hotel bill six weeks into filming. "I looked at my bill and I started laughing," said Goggins, recalling his disbelief upon discovering the cost of his incidentals. He questioned the seemingly exorbitant price of Thai spiced cashews, only to find out that they indeed accounted for a significant portion of his bill.

When host Stephen Colbert asked about the quantity of cashews consumed, Goggins admitted to having indulged in more than he initially thought. "I thought I had maybe, like, five. And they said, 'No, you had 30.'" he confessed, adding to the surprise of the unexpected expense.

Goggins also revealed an additional expense related to his alcohol consumption during filming, admitting to purchasing a $150 bottle of prosecco. Colbert humorously questioned whether such an expense was justified, holding up a photo of Goggins posing with the bottle by the ocean. "It was a good time; it was a really good time," said Goggins, emphasizing the overall enjoyment of his experience despite the financial surprises.

Joining Walton Goggins in "The White Lotus" season 3 are Carrie Coon, Scott Glenn, Michelle Monaghan, Parker Posey, Leslie Bibb, Blackpink member Lisa (credited as Lalisa Manobal), Dom Hetrakul, Jason Isaacs, Tayme Thapthimthong, Sarah Catherine Hook, Sam Nivola, Patrick Schwarzenegger, Aimee Lou Wood, Nicholas Duvernay, Francesca Corney, Arnas Fedaravičius, Christian Friedel, Morgana O'Reilly, Lek Patravadi, and Shalini Peiris. The highly anticipated third season of the hit HBO series is set to premiere in 2025.
